Wings Lifestyle launches Wings Switch, magnetic switch control earphones at Rs.1499/-

Wings Lifestyle is out with their latest earphone Wings Switch priced at Rs.1,499. These earphones are a perfect blend of electronics and fashion accessories. The unique feature of this earphone is that it comes with Magnetic Switch Control which automatically pauses music when the magnetic ear tips are stuck together and plays music when they are pulled apart and put into the ear. This is a great feature addition to the existing Bluetooth earphones range and the first such earphone in the Indian market.
It has a battery life of 160 mAh which gives playing and talk time upto 10 hours with only 1.5 hours charging time. It is compatible with all android /IOS and windows devices including mobiles, tabs and laptops. It has a built in mic - 3 button control for completely hands free calling, rejecting calls, adjusting volume and changing songs. It also comes with Siri / Google voice assistant activation. The earphone has HD Bass which provides clear, deep bass along with clear vocals. It is perfect for listening to EDM, Bollywood and acoustic songs.
